2RF9 Transferase date Sep 28, 2007
title Crystal Structure Of The Complex Between The Egfr Kinase Dom Mig6 Peptide
authors X.Zhang, K.A.Pickin, R.Bose, N.Jura, P.A.Cole, J.Kuriyan
compound source
Molecule: Epidermal Growth Factor Receptor
Chain: A, B
Fragment: Protein Kinase Domain
Synonym: Receptor Tyrosine-Protein Kinase Erbb-1
Ec: 2.7.10.1
Engineered: Yes
Organism_scientific: Homo Sapiens
Organism_common: Human
Organism_taxid: 9606
Gene: Egfr, Erbb1
Expression_system: Spodoptera Frugiperda
Expression_system_common: Fall Armyworm
Expression_system_taxid: 7108
Expression_system_strain: Sf9
Expression_system_vector_type: Baculorvirus
Expression_system_plasmid: Pfastbac-Ht

Molecule: Erbb Receptor Feedback Inhibitor 1
Chain: C, D
Fragment: Sequence Database Residues, 315-374
Synonym: Mitogen-Inducible Gene 6 Protein, Mig-6
Engineered: Yes

Organism_scientific: Homo Sapiens
Organism_common: Human
Organism_taxid: 9606
Gene: Errfi1, Mig6
Expression_system: Escherichia Coli Bl21(De3)
Expression_system_taxid: 469008
Expression_system_strain: Bl21(De3)
Expression_system_vector_type: Plasmid
Expression_system_plasmid: Pgex6p1
symmetry Space Group: C 1 2 1
R_factor 0.272 R_Free 0.329
